Owner Complaints for the 2009 BMW R 1200 RT US
2 complaints have been filed with NHTSA for the 2009 BMW R 1200 RT US. Below is a breakdown by vehicle component.
| Component | Complaints | Crashes | Fires | Injuries | Deaths |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Fuelpropulsion System |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Most Recent Complaints
STARTED THE BIKE AND FUEL STARTED SPRAYING ALL OVER THE TOP OF THE ENGINE. TOOK OFF THE FUEL TANK AND THERE IS A CRACK IN THE FUEL PUMP ASSEMBLY. *TR
FUEL GAUGE FAILURE DUE TO DEFECTIVE SENDING STRIP. FIRST STRIP FAILED APPROX. 52,000 MILES; SECOND STRIP FAILED WITHIN ONE TANKFUL OF REPLACEMENT. NOW ON THIRD SENDING STRIP. KNOWN PROBLEM ON MULTIPLE YEARS OF BMW MOTORCYCLES WITH NO MANUFACTURER RESPONSE. *TR
